Exchange Relationship
This type of relationship is based on the principle of give-and-take, where interactions are often governed by the need for equity and reciprocity between the parties involved.
Reciprocity
A mutual exchange of privileges, goods, services, or other forms of value, often characterized by a balancing of benefits between the parties involved.
Direct Benefit
An advantage or gain that directly results from a specific action, policy, or investment, without intermediate steps.
Communal Relationships
Interpersonal connections where individuals emphasize mutual care and concern for each other's welfare.
